One in five elderly patients are readmitted to the hospital within 30 days of leaving, according to government data. This revolving door of Medicare patients alone costs $26 billion annually, with $17 billion paying for trips that could be prevented upon patients receiving the right care. » Full article

The painful transition to the ICD-10 classification scheme has been made substantially more painful by repeated delays in the implementation date. Further training, education and testing are crucial, assuming that the transition does go forward in October 2015.

ACA coverage options have enabled legal loopholes that allow parents to opt out of pediatric dental coverage. HHS data suggest that as few as one in five children with ACA healthcare policies may have dental coverage this year.
